His parents were John Severt Berg and Olava Berg.I don't know if they came over from Norway or not. I know nothing of this family.
On the 1880 census he is listed as a cook in a lumber camp.When he moved to Washington State he bought a farm so for a time he was a farmer.
On the 12th of Sept 1893 John signed his final papers to
become a citizen of the United States of America in Clark County Washington.
Mother said when he disappeared he went out to look for work and never came back. They thought he went back to Norway but I found out he was admitted to a Mental Institute in Washington State in 1900 and released in 1905. By this time Effie had sold the farm and moved her family to Portland, Oregon.
John was my great-grandfather and I would like to know what happened to him after his release from the Mental Hospital I am still researching.
